A federal lawsuit has been filed against Houston County Jail in Alabama, alleging that jail staff ignored a woman’s labor for more than 24 hours, leaving fellow inmates to deliver her baby. The case could carry significant financial exposure for the county, including potential settlement costs and increased insurance premiums.

A federal lawsuit was recently filed by Tiffany McElroy against Houston County Jail, claiming that jail staff failed to provide medical assistance during her labor. According to the complaint, McElroy’s labor continued for more than 24 hours without any intervention from jail personnel. Fellow inmates ultimately delivered the baby, as staff allegedly did not respond to repeated requests for help. The lawsuit seeks unspecified damages for negligence and violation of civil rights. The incident, which occurred in the past, has drawn attention to the standards of medical care in correctional facilities. Attorneys for McElroy argue that the jail’s failure to act violated her constitutional rights and caused unnecessary physical and emotional distress. Houston County officials have not yet issued a public statement regarding the lawsuit. The case is expected to proceed through the federal court system, with discovery and potential motions in the coming months. Key Highlights

- The lawsuit alleges that jail staff ignored McElroy’s labor for over 24 hours, with no medical personnel present. - Fellow inmates delivered the baby, highlighting potential gaps in emergency response protocols at the facility. - Financial risks for Houston County include legal defense costs, potential damages, and possible increases in liability insurance premiums. - The case may set a precedent for how correctional facilities handle medical emergencies, potentially leading to policy changes and increased training requirements. - Similar lawsuits against county jails have resulted in settlements ranging from hundreds of thousands to millions of dollars, depending on the severity of the claims. Expert Insights

Legal analysts suggest that this lawsuit could carry substantial financial implications for Houston County. If the case proceeds to trial, legal fees alone could run into six figures, and any award for damages could be significantly higher. Insurance companies may also reassess the county’s risk profile, potentially leading to higher premiums or difficulty obtaining coverage. Beyond direct costs, the case could prompt state or federal oversight of medical care in Alabama jails, which may require additional funding for training, staffing, and equipment. Correctional facilities nationwide are facing increased scrutiny over medical neglect claims, and this lawsuit may further accelerate demands for reform. From a policy perspective, the incident underscores the need for clear protocols to ensure timely medical response for detainees. While no specific financial projections are available, the broader trend suggests that counties without adequate medical infrastructure may face growing liability exposure. Stakeholders would likely consider investing in telemedicine or on-site nursing staff to mitigate such risks in the future.
